Emerson 1C31179G01 I/O Remote Module | Replacement, Equivalent & Selection Guide
The Emerson 1C31179G01 is an Input/Output Remote Module designed for use within the Emerson Ovation Distributed Control System (DCS). It serves as a critical interface between field instruments and the control network, enabling reliable real-time data acquisition and output control in demanding industrial environments. Technical Specifications
- Part Number: 1C31179G01
- Manufacturer: Emerson Electric / Emerson Automation Solutions
- Series: Ovation DCS I/O Subsystem
- Module Type: Input/Output Remote Module
- Form Factor: Rack-mount card module
- Weight: 630 g (approx.)
- Country of Origin: United States
- Communication: Compatible with Ovation controller backplane and remote I/O bus
- Operating Environment: Industrial-grade; suitable for power generation, oil & gas, and process control facilities

System Compatibility
- DCS Platform: Emerson Ovation™ Distributed Control System
- Controller Compatibility: Compatible with Ovation OCR400, OCR1100, and related controller families (verify with system documentation)
- I/O Bus: Ovation Remote I/O Bus
- Software: Ovation Developer Studio; compatible with standard Ovation configuration tools
- Rack/Chassis: Standard Ovation I/O rack; verify slot type before ordering
Selection Guide
Use the following criteria to determine whether the 1C31179G01 or an alternative is the right choice for your application:
- Step 1 – Identify Signal Type: Confirm whether your field signals are analog (4–20 mA, voltage) or digital (discrete on/off). Match to the correct I/O module type.
- Step 2 – Check Channel Count: Verify the number of I/O channels required per module against your P&ID and loop list.
- Step 3 – Confirm Rack Slot: Ensure the module is compatible with your existing Ovation I/O rack slot type and backplane revision.
- Step 4 – Review Firmware Version: Match the module firmware to your Ovation controller software version to avoid compatibility issues.

Q: Is this module compatible with Emerson DeltaV systems?
A: No. The 1C31179G01 is designed specifically for the Emerson Ovation DCS platform and is not compatible with DeltaV architectures.
